What sorts of options does Pathfinder have for a dedicated aberration hunter? I知 aware of the slayer archetype, which looks interesting, but I知 wondering if there are other options available for druids or rangers.

I知 thinking of a druid who specializes in exterminating aberrations, and right now some combination of druid/slayer seems promising. Are there any options for the druid that would help with this? Or other, non-druid options that are too good to pass up?

While Pureblade is quite good, the combination of Ranger 1/Druid 5 with the Shapeshifting Hunter feat allow you to progress Fav.Enemy based on your combined Dru/Rgr levels. Add Fav. Enemy Spellcasting (Abberrations) and you're golden.

The Green Scourge (https://www.d20pfsrd.com/classes/core-classes/druid/archetypes/paizo-druid-archetypes/green-scourge-druid-archetype/) druid fits the bill. Detect aberration (https://www.d20pfsrd.com/magic/all-spells/d/detect-aberration/) is also a druid spell. If you are specifically anti aboleth, you could go with gillman as a race. Gillmen also have a racial feat (https://www.d20pfsrd.com/feats/general-feats/aberration-bane-caster/) that helps cast against aberrations. Drow and gnomes have alternative racial traits specifically against aberrations.

Alchemists have a few things that fit, but mostly relating to oozes. The cavalier/samurai order of the green (http://www.d20pfsrd.com/classes/base-classes/cavalier/orders/paizo-cavalier-orders/order-of-the-green-cavalier-order-2/)gives bonuses against aberrations and undead.
